I need a crystal for my project and I found this crystal:
https://mouser.com/ProductDetail/TXC-Corporation/9C-16000MAAJ-T?qs=sGAEpiMZZMsBj6bBr9Q9aWUu9Vmt5DeozjX1gZsyHq8%3D

To calculate the two capacitances for the crystal i used this equation:
CL = (C1 * C2) / (C1 + C2) + Cstray

But the datasheet only giving Cshunt. Is it the same as Cstray?
After calculating with Cshunt for Cstray I come to a value of 22pF.

Best Answer

The stray capacitance is the parasitic capacitance present on the pcb board (due to proximity to components) plus the capacitance of the pins. As a rule of thumb, a value for Cstray is on the order of ~5pF.

The shunt capacitance is another parameter and it's mainly a concern for the internal oscillator circuit.
